Unfortunately, the consumer really doesn't have any other choice. You have to pay what's at the pump, and places like Hawaii have decided to go to the legislature and say put a cap on prices. The problem you have there is gas lines. Because companies selling fuel, they'll simply sell it somewhere else and then you'll have a shortage in your jurisdiction.

The IDE products have consistent revenue but it's a very low margin business. There's a big upside for Borland if they can succeed in software delivery optimization, and these other areas, which is a much higher margin; you're selling to enterprise IT management rather than to individuals and resellers.

The problem is you can't build a refinery overnight it takes a couple of years, so what we're probably going to see over the next 18 to 24 months is continued increases in prices.
